Septic & Well Water Services in Wakulla County, FL
North Florida Gulf Coast county south of Tallahassee with flat terrain, sandy soils, and the world-famous Wakulla Springs, one of the largest and deepest freshwater springs. The unconfined Floridan Aquifer is extremely vulnerable, and septic systems are a documented contributor to declining spring water quality and increasing nitrate levels. Wells are shallow into the Floridan Aquifer with hard water, and the county is a focal point for advanced OSTDS requirements to protect springs.

What's the average cost of septic installation in Wakulla County?
- Septic system installation in Wakulla County typically ranges from $5,000 to $15,000 depending on system type, soil conditions, and property layout. Get free estimates from licensed installers in our directory to compare pricing.
How often should I pump my septic tank in Wakulla County?
- Most Wakulla County homeowners should have their septic tank pumped every 3–5 years. With 5 providers available in Wakulla County, finding a qualified pumping service is easy. Factors like household size, tank capacity, and water usage can affect the schedule.
